Output 8b8f0fa26405ad8ec42c115ec34f0df9ce8be3dfebe147ae838e48c8b5de679f:1

value
2673561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 841fc64f83e09cfeefcd6e38306a3144e496ec73 OP_EQUAL
address
3DjdBc9ZrCmiiie9Zixkq6a4j74KPLihuq
transaction
8b8f0fa26405ad8ec42c115ec34f0df9ce8be3dfebe147ae838e48c8b5de679f
confirmations
350758
spent
true